I played it for a bit and here's what stood out to me:
- too hard to unlock the mouse to be able to access the sidebar menus
- optimal knife strat seems to be to spam repeatedly which makes it feel unfair when it kills you
- the ais are really dumb, maybe making them zombies would help perception
